How what is md5 technology can Save You Time, Stress, and Money.
How what is md5 technology can Save You Time, Stress, and Money.
Blog Article
MD5 can be nevertheless used in cybersecurity to verify and authenticate electronic signatures. Working with MD5, a consumer can verify that a downloaded file is reliable by matching the private and non-private important and hash values. A result of the large fee of MD5 collisions, on the other hand, this message-digest algorithm is not really perfect for verifying the integrity of information or files as menace actors can easily substitute the hash worth with among their own personal.
MD5 continues to be being used currently like a hash perform even though it's been exploited For several years. On this page, we explore what MD5 is; It truly is background, and how it can be employed right now.
In 2004 it was shown that MD5 isn't collision-resistant.[27] As such, MD5 isn't ideal for programs like SSL certificates or digital signatures that count on this home for digital safety. Researchers In addition found much more severe flaws in MD5, and described a feasible collision assault—a technique to produce a set of inputs for which MD5 makes similar checksums.
The explanations why MD5 hashes usually are published in hexadecimal transcend the scope of your posting, but not less than now you recognize that the letters genuinely just depict a distinct counting program.
In 2005, a functional collision was demonstrated applying two X.509 certificates with diverse public keys and a similar MD5 hash price. Days afterwards, an algorithm was produced that might construct MD5 collisions in just some hrs.
Greatly enhance the short article using your knowledge. Contribute into the GeeksforGeeks Group read more and support develop much better learning methods for all.
Some MD5 implementations for instance md5sum might be restricted to octets, or they might not assistance streaming for messages of an originally undetermined size.
Considering the fact that technology is just not going any where and does far more great than hurt, adapting is the best class of motion. That's where by The Tech Edvocate comes in. We plan to protect the PreK-12 and better Training EdTech sectors and supply our readers with the newest news and belief on the subject.
Progress infrastructure administration solutions velocity the time and reduce the energy necessary to take care of your community, purposes and fundamental infrastructure.
Published as RFC 1321 all-around thirty many years ago, the MD5 information-digest algorithm continues to be widely applied nowadays. Using the MD5 algorithm, a 128-little bit a lot more compact output can be established from a message enter of variable length. This is the form of cryptographic hash that's meant to make digital signatures, compressing large files into lesser types inside a protected method after which you can encrypting them with A non-public ( or magic formula) key to get matched having a general public key. MD5 can even be used to detect file corruption or inadvertent variations inside of significant collections of information to be a command-line implementation employing common Laptop languages such as Java, Perl, or C.
The size from the hash worth (128 bits) is small enough to contemplate a birthday attack. MD5CRK was a dispersed project began in March 2004 to show that MD5 is virtually insecure by finding a collision utilizing a birthday attack.
Transferring a single space to your left, we contain the variety “c”, which is actually just twelve in hexadecimal. Given that it's the third digit from the right, this time we multiply it by sixteen to the power of two.
Created by Ronald Rivest in 1991, MD5 was initially built to become a cryptographic hash function. It's going to take an enter message of arbitrary duration and generates a 128-bit hash price. The algorithm operates on 32-bit text and contains a number of rounds of little bit-degree manipulations.
Even though it provides stronger stability ensures, it isn’t as widely adopted as its predecessors mainly because it’s tougher to apply and present programs demand updates to introduce it.